Bryce Canyon National Park

4.7
Hiking Trails · Lookouts · Geologic Formations
You can find hoodoos--rock pillars formed by erosion--all around the world, but those of Bryce Canyon National Park remain the standard bearers thanks to their bright red color, tall stature, and arrangement in large amphitheaters. Bryce remains relatively isolated because of its south-central Utah location, which limits visitors and provides uncrowded views. The park also sits at a high altitude: the highest part, Rainbow Point, reaches 2,775 m (9,105 ft). A paved road snakes for 29 km (18 mi) through the park, delivering sweeping vistas of the gigantic and magnificent rock statues. Hiking and horseback riding provide alternative ways of sightseeing in the park if you prefer not to spend your time behind the wheel.
